Transaction 50784023c8a38cca50122a0d503c612133761815082a1966026423e58771e1f2
1 Input
1 Output
-
50784023c8a38cca50122a0d503c612133761815082a1966026423e58771e1f2:0
- value
- 579254
- script pubkey
- OP_0 OP_PUSHBYTES_32 612e8fae5ce412015b44c96bab7c432940b86290db20ab0b6b6693f86e5ebb9b
- address
- bc1qvyhgltjuusfqzk6ye946klzr99qtsc5smvs2kzmtv6flsmj7hwdsrscv8l